Westport PAL - Court Jesters Charity Basketball Game on behalf of Rainbow

The comedy basketball talents of the Court Jesters and their world famous showman Rainbow have been part of the Westport PAL basketball program for the past fifteen years.  Rainbow was always known as the King of Comedy Basketball.  He performed in gyms all over Westport, entertaining and inspiring our youth.  After a brave battle against pancreatic and liver cancer, Rainbow recently passed away.  To honor Rainbow, the Court Jesters are conducting a fund-raiser to help Rainbow's family pay the expenses of his cancer fight.  All proceeds will go to support Rainbow's family.  Here is an opportunity to give back to someone who has given so much to our community.

On Saturday, July 27th, the Court Jesters will play against former New England professional athletes at the Naismith Hall of Fame in Springfield, MA.

Scheduled to appear for the New England Pros are Nate "Tiny" Archibald, Terry O'Reilly, Ken Hodge, JoJo White, Steve Grogan, Tim Wakefield, Jason Varitek and many others.  The All-Stars will be coached by Westport PAL Basketball's Howie Friedman.
